1. Protection from Harmful UV Rays

One of the first things I learned about sunglasses is how essential they are for protecting my eyes from the sun's ultraviolet (UV) rays. Over time, prolonged exposure to UV rays can cause serious eye conditions, such as cataracts, macular degeneration, and even eye cancers. I used to think that wearing sunglasses was only necessary on bright, sunny days, but I soon realized that UV rays are harmful year-round, even on cloudy days.

Wearing sunglasses with proper UV protection has helped me avoid unnecessary strain on my eyes. Whenever I’m outside, whether it’s for a walk, driving, or just enjoying the outdoors, I always wear sunglasses to shield my eyes from these invisible rays. Most sunglasses these days offer UV400 protection, which blocks 100% of UVA and UVB rays, providing the best protection for my eyes.

2. Reduced Risk of Eye Diseases

In addition to preventing immediate discomfort, wearing sunglasses daily has long-term health benefits. As I researched more about eye care, I realized that consistent UV exposure can contribute to serious eye diseases, including cataracts (clouding of the eye's lens) and macular degeneration (damage to the retina). These conditions are not only painful but can also lead to vision loss.

By wearing sunglasses regularly, I’m protecting my eyes from these diseases. It's a simple habit that goes a long way in preventing eye damage and ensuring that I can enjoy clear vision well into my later years. I’m especially cautious during the summer months when the sun is at its peak, but I also wear sunglasses during winter or on overcast days when UV rays are still present.

4. Reduction of Eye Strain and Glare

One of the immediate benefits I noticed when I began wearing sunglasses daily was the reduction in eye strain and glare. Whenever I’m outside during midday or driving into the sun, the glare from bright light can be incredibly uncomfortable, often causing my eyes to water or even feel fatigued. Sunglasses with polarized lenses have been a game-changer in this regard.

Polarized sunglasses block out horizontal light waves, which reduce glare from reflective surfaces like water, snow, or the road. I’ve found that wearing these sunglasses while driving not only makes the experience more comfortable but also improves my overall visibility. It’s no surprise that eye strain can lead to headaches or fatigue, so reducing glare with the right pair of sunglasses has been a real improvement in my daily life.

6. Better Vision and Improved Focus

I’ve also noticed that wearing sunglasses has helped me maintain better vision and improved my focus, especially in bright conditions. On particularly sunny days, the light can be so intense that it makes it hard to see clearly. Sunglasses with a darker lens tint help reduce brightness and enhance contrast, making it easier for me to see what’s in front of me. This has been especially helpful while driving, where clear vision is crucial for safety.

In addition, the ability to focus without squinting means I’m not straining my eyes, which can help me stay focused for longer periods. For people who have sensitive eyes or conditions like photophobia (light sensitivity), wearing sunglasses becomes even more critical to reduce discomfort and improve vision clarity.
